Pineapple Fluff: A Light and Tropical No-Bake Favorite

📖 The Origin of Pineapple Fluff

Pineapple Fluff belongs to the beloved family of “dessert salads” — creamy, fruit-filled mixtures that rose to popularity in the mid-20th century. With ingredients like whipped topping, canned fruits, marshmallows, and pudding mix, fluff desserts became go-to recipes for their simplicity, affordability, and nostalgic charm.

Today, pineapple fluff remains a crowd-pleaser, especially during the warmer months when oven-free recipes are a must.

🛒 Ingredients

  • 1 can (20 oz) crushed pineapple, drained
  • 1 package (3.4 oz) instant vanilla pudding mix
  • 1 tub (8 oz) Cool Whip, thawed
  • 1 cup mini marshmallows
  • ½ cup shredded coconut (optional)
  • ½ cup chopped pecans or walnuts (optional)
  • ½ cup maraschino cherries, halved (optional)

👩‍🍳 Instructions

  1. Mix the Base: In a large bowl, combine drained pineapple and pudding mix. Stir until thickened.
  2. Fold in Whipped Topping: Gently fold in Cool Whip until light and fluffy.
  3. Add the Extras: Stir in mini marshmallows, coconut, nuts, and cherries.
  4. Chill: Cover and refrigerate for at least 1 hour before serving.
  5. Serve and Enjoy: Serve cold, and garnish with extra cherries or coconut if desired.

🧊 Storage & Reheating

Refrigerator: Store in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
Freezer: Not recommended — the whipped topping and texture may become grainy when thawed.
Reheating: Not applicable — always serve cold!

Notes

💡 Pro Tips for Pineapple Fluff Salad Drain the pineapple well to avoid a watery salad—press gently with a spoon to release excess juice. Use cold ingredients for the fluffiest texture—Cool Whip and pineapple straight from the fridge work best. Fold gently to keep the whipped topping light and airy—don’t stir too hard or it may deflate. Chill before serving for at least 1 hour (or overnight) to let the flavors meld and marshmallows soften. Customize easily by swapping cherries for mandarin oranges, or adding crushed graham crackers for crunch. Serve in individual cups for easy presentation at parties or potlucks!

🔄 Popular Variations of Pineapple Fluff

This dessert is easily customizable. Try these popular variations:

  • 🌴 Tropical Fluff: Add diced mango, mandarin oranges, or banana.
  • 💚 Pistachio Fluff: Swap in pistachio pudding for a green twist.
  • 🍫 Pineapple Oreo Fluff: Add crushed Golden Oreos for crunch.
  • 🍓 Berry Fluff: Stir in strawberries or blueberries.
  • 🥥 Coconut Cream Fluff: Use coconut pudding and top with toasted coconut.

❓ FAQs

Can I make pineapple fluff ahead of time?
Yes! Pineapple fluff is actually better when made in advance. Chill it for at least 1 hour or up to 24 hours before serving to allow the flavors to meld.

Can I use fresh pineapple instead of canned?
It’s best to use canned crushed pineapple for the right texture and moisture balance. Fresh pineapple can affect how the pudding sets due to its natural enzymes.

Is there a way to make it lighter or healthier?
Absolutely! Use sugar-free pudding mix, light Cool Whip, and unsweetened coconut to cut down on sugar and calories.

Can I freeze pineapple fluff?
Freezing isn’t recommended as it may affect the texture. It’s best enjoyed fresh from the fridge.

What can I use instead of Cool Whip?
You can substitute with homemade whipped cream, but keep in mind it won’t be as stable for long-term storage.

Can I add other fruits or mix-ins?
Yes! Mandarin oranges, diced bananas, crushed graham crackers, or mini chocolate chips are fun add-ins for extra flavor and texture.
